Drawing mode
If heated water is drawn from a tap, the main control changes to drawing mode and,
depending on the set outlet temperature, changes the background colour from blue
for low temperatures to red for high temperatures. In this mode the scale ring displays
the actual power consumption of the appliance.

Venting after maintenance work
This instantaneous water heater features an automatic air bubble protection to prevent
it from inadvertently running dry. Nevertheless, the appliance must be vented before
using it for the first time. Each time the appliance is emptied (e.g. after work on the
plumbing system, if there is a risk of frost or following repair work), the appliance must
be revented before it is used again.
1. Disconnect the instantaneous water heater from the mains (e.g. via deactivating the
fuses).
2. Unscrew the jet regulator on the outlet fitting and open the cold water tap valve to
rinse out the water pipe and avoid contaminating the appliance or the jet regulator.
3. Open and close the hot water tap until no more air emerges from the pipe and all
air has been eliminated from the water heater.
4. Only then should you reconnect the power supply again (e.g. via activating the
fuses) to the instantaneous water heater and screw the jet regulator back in.
5. The appliance activates the heater after approx. 10 seconds of continuous water
flow.
Cleaning and maintenance
• Plastic surfaces and fittings should only be wiped with a damp cloth. Do not use
abrasive or chlorinebased cleaning agents or solvents.
• For a good water supply, the outlet fittings (special tap aerators and shower heads)
should be unscrewed and cleaned at regular intervals. Every three years, the electri
cal and plumbing components should be inspected by an authorised professional in
order to ensure proper functioning and operational safety at all times.
